Responsibilities

As a Graduate Construction Manager – Year Out Placement, you’ll gain experience on live construction sites, learning how to plan, manage and deliver building projects from start to finish. With the support of experienced site managers and project leaders, you’ll:

  • Assist in the day-to-day management of site operations, ensuring works are completed safely and on programme
  • Support the coordination of subcontractors, suppliers and site teams
  • Contribute to planning meetings and progress reviews with project managers and clients
  • Monitor quality standards, health & safety compliance and environmental performance
  • Support managing site logistics, temporary works, and sequencing of activities
  • Develop an understanding of commercial processes and cost control
  • Produce and maintain accurate site records and reports
  • Start building relationships with clients, consultants, and subcontractors to support effective project delivery
